Kengo Misaki (三崎 健吾, Misaki Kengo) is a fictional character from the Baki the Grappler anime and manga series. He is a Shorinji Kempo user who took part in the Maximum Tournament.

Personality

Kengo is a man with a calm personality, even when he is fighting or in trouble. As a monk, Kengo avoids seriously damaging his enemies, using submission techniques and giving them the option to surrender, as happened with Mike Quinn. Likewise, if his enemy is very strong he will have no problem using lethal techniques such as stomp or stabbing his throat, as happened to Jack Hanma.

Appearance

Kengo is a short man with a slim build and shaved head. Both inside and outside the ring he wears a white and blue Kasaya (the robes of Buddhist monks), he appears barefoot in all his appearances.

History

Baki the Grappler

Maximum Tournament Saga

He was invited to the Underground Arena as one of the 36 fighters of the Maximum Tournament.

In the first round, he fight Mike Quinn whom he beat using an Armlock to make him surrender. In the second round, he fights Jack Hammer who beat Kengo after biting off many pieces of skin, causing him to collapse from blood loss.

In the manga, appears at the end of the tournament congratulating along with the rest of the fighters to Baki Hanma for winning the final match.

His whereabouts and current status is unknown.

Abilities

Kengo Misaki is a strong fighter who uses Shorinji Kempo. He could easily defeat a famous pro wrestler Mike Quinn with an armlock. But he was unable to defeat Jack Hanma who could easily withstand Kengo's attacks. Jack bite his wrist and ankle off, and then he defeated him with a few punches.
